About Jurang Yan

Jurang Yan is a scholar working on Numerical Analysis, Applied Mathematics and Modeling and Simulation, having authored 119 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nonlinear Differential Equations Analysis (102 papers), Differential Equations and Numerical Methods (70 papers) and Mathematical and Theoretical Epidemiology and Ecology Models (43 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Numerical Analysis (866 citations), Applied Mathematics (1.4k citations) and Modeling and Simulation (436 citations). Jurang Yan has collaborated with scholars based in China, Spain and United States. Frequent co-authors include Aimin Zhao, Guirong Liu, Aimin Zhao, Juan J. Nieto, Quanxin Zhang, Jianhua Shen, Jianhua Shen, Fengqin Zhang, Xiao Hu and Chen Yang.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Fuzzy Sets and Systems and Neurocomputing.
